Jade is a die-hard fan of all things supernatural. He sits in front of the television adoring his favourite superheroes but doesn't feel one of them for sure.. mortally afraid of being bullied, he despises his helplessness to save his courage who he finds to be struggling against his cowardice.. He lives happily with his mom coping up with his lifestyle, and is a favourite amongst his neighbours , makes others happy always and dreams of becoming something or someone memorable.. But does he trusts his instincts..? Does Jade's fortune change? Destiny awaits......

Ayn is a witch with healing powers. Shapeshifters have killed her parents and the only animals she cannot speak with are wolves. When she graduates from the Teaching Clan and finds out that she has to cross the River and live in the Wolves' Mountains for one year, she is less than amused. Kari, first-born shapeshifter Alpha, almost lost his wolf after the death of his mate. He could rise again and become the pack leader if only he would complete his training ...and find another suitable Luna. When he realizes that his second chance is his mother's guest, a daydreaming stubborn witch from across the River, he is less than amused. The bond may be a strong force, but can a witch walk the Wolves' Way and face the dangers it is paved with? **** "I need to stop..."
